Failed findings

  • food received at unsafe tempscritical
    Official wording: Hand Washing Facilities: With Soap And Sanitary Hand Drying Devices, Convenient And Accessible To Food Prep Area
    Inspector note: Found the cooking line exposed handsink inaccessible with a container of thawing egg product inside as well as not maintained due to no soap being available. Instructed facility that all handsinks must be accessible at all times with hot and cold running water, soap, and paper towels. Manager removed product and installed soap during inspection. Critical violation 7-38-030.
    code 12Priority
  • Outside Garbage Waste Grease And Storage Area; Clean, Rodent Proof, All Containers Covered
    Inspector note: Observed the outside garbage and waste grease area not maintained: found grease and oil encrusted on the top of the waste grease container and found food and garbage debris scattered all around the garbage enclosure and cans. Instructed facility to remove all garbage and debris and deposit in appropriate containers. Instructed to clean and maintain top of waste grease container. Instructed to maintain garbage enclosure free of loose debris and food and all lids clean and tight fitting to help prevent pest harborage and feeding. Serious violation 7-38-020.

  • Food And Non-Food Contact Surfaces Properly Designed, Constructed And Maintained
    Inspector note: Found the cutting board at the 2 door sandwich cooler with deep, dark grooves in it. Instructed facility to replace and maintain.
    code 32
  • food prep surfaces dirty
    Official wording: Food And Non-Food Contact Equipment Utensils Clean, Free Of Abrasive Detergents
    Inspector note: Observed the top shelf above the cooking line coolers/service window to be dirty with food and dust. Instructed facility to clean and maintain.
    code 33
  • Floors: Constructed Per Code, Cleaned, Good Repair, Coving Installed, Dust-Less Cleaning Methods Used
    Inspector note: Observed dirt and debris on the floor in various areas: under and around the dish machine, under and behind the ice machine, behind the coolers and equipment on the cooking line, by the rear soda boxes, and by the server station in the dining room. Instructed facility to clean and maintain.
    code 34
  • Walls, Ceilings, Attached Equipment Constructed Per Code: Good Repair, Surfaces Clean And Dust-Less Cleaning Methods
    Inspector note: Observed dirt and black markings on walls surrounding the dish machine. Instructed facility to clean and maintain.
    code 35
  • pests in the house
    Official wording: Ventilation: Rooms And Equipment Vented As Required: Plumbing: Installed And Maintained
    Inspector note: Observed a white PVC pipe exiting the bottom rear of the ice machine and dripping water directly on to the floor. Instructed facility to connect to a floor drain and maintain.
